The Toronto Maple Leafs face the Carolina Hurricanes with both teams looking to build off strong starts to the season. The Maple Leafs have a 6-4-2 record while the Hurricanes have an 8-2-1 record and with four wins in a row have the best record in the Metropolitan Division. The Maple Leafs are looking to improve in the Atlantic Division while the Hurricanes look to remain in first place in the Metropolitan Division and the upcoming game should be a great one as a result.

The Maple Leafs are having a strong season but hope the offense can step up, scoring only 2.91 goals per game. While William Nylander, John Tavares, and Mitch Marner have scored 13 goals and 23 assists to lead the top two lines, the rest of the offense has struggled. The hope is that Alexander Kerfoot and Michael Bunting can step up as they play a pivotal role in the forward unit but have only scored three goals and seven assists to start the season.

The offense has struggled but the defense has carried the Maple Leafs, allowing only 2.91 goals per game. Mark Giordano and T.J. Brodie have combined for 1.5 defensive point shares and 36 blocked shots to lead the top two pairings but the rest of the unit has also played well with Justin Holl, Morgan Rielly, and Rasmus Sandin combining for 1.3 defensive point shares to add depth to the defense. With the Maple Leafs playing a back-to-back, the hope is that backup Erik Kallgren can step up as he's struggled with a .875 save percentage and a 3.62 goals-against average on 88 shots.
